Hvem er løfter

The lift operator plays an important role in everyday life by ensuring safe and efficient transportation of goods and people between floors of buildings. They constantly check the functionality of the elevators, monitor their operation, resolve malfunctions, and ensure compliance with safety rules during elevator use. The lift operator pays close attention to the loading of the elevator to avoid overloading. When a problem arises, they quickly respond, conduct diagnostic testing, find solutions, and coordinate repair work. In cases where the elevator stops, the lift operator assists passengers, ensuring their comfort and safety. They often communicate with other team members to exchange information about the elevator's status and plan repairs. The lift operator learns new technologies and methods to improve their skills and ensure greater safety and convenience for users.

Arbeidstid og betingelser

En løfteoperatør jobber vanligvis 8 timer om dagen. Fridagene kan variere, og er som regel angitt etter timeplanen. Dette er en jobb på stedet, uten mulighet for fjernarbeid. Arbeidet innebærer å løfte laster, så fysisk belastning må forventes. I noen tilfeller kan det være endringer i arbeidsplanen hvis det er behov for hasteoppgaver.
